Product Description:
(1-Cyclobutylpyrazol-4-yl)boronic acid is primarily utilized in organic synthesis, particularly in Suzuki-Miyaura cross-coupling reactions. This compound serves as a key intermediate for constructing complex molecules, especially in the pharmaceutical industry, where it aids in the development of drug candidates. Its boronic acid group enables efficient coupling with aryl halides, facilitating the creation of biaryl structures commonly found in active pharmaceutical ingredients. Additionally, it is employed in the synthesis of agrochemicals and advanced materials, contributing to the production of compounds with specific biological or physical properties. Its versatility and reactivity make it a valuable tool in modern synthetic chemistry.
